Abstract
The utility model relates to a glass refrigerator door with no frame in front face and belongs to technical field of a refrigerator. The glass refrigerator door with no frame in front face comprises a refrigerator door frame body (1), a glass panel (2) and a door body rear panel (3) are respectively arranged in the front face and the back face of the refrigerator door frame body (1), and a foaming layer (4) is filled among the refrigerator door frame body (1), the glass panel (2) and the door body rear panel (3). The glass refrigerator door with no frame in front face is characterized in that the glass panel (2) is covered on the front face of the refrigerator door frame body (1). The glass refrigerator door with no frame in front face has the advantages of being beautiful in appearance and long in service life, reducing cost in production procession, improving production efficiency and reducing rejection rate.

Background technology
Along with the raising of living standards of the people, also have higher requirement for the performance attractive in appearance of various daily household electrical appliance.Refrigerator is as one of daily household electrical appliance of extensive use, and importance attractive in appearance is self-evident.In order to increase performance attractive in appearance, existing refrigerator door plank is commonly face glass, as depicted in figs. 1 and 2, this refrigerator doors comprises refrigerator doors framework body 1, the front of refrigerator doors framework body 1 and the back side are respectively equipped with face glass 2 and door body backboard 3, offer the glass caulking groove on the refrigerator doors framework body 1, face glass 2 is embedded in the glass caulking groove, is filled with foaming layer 4 between refrigerator doors framework body 1, face glass 2 and the door body backboard 3.
Because refrigerator doors framework body is provided with the glass caulking groove, so that the structure of refrigerator doors framework body is comparatively complicated.Refrigerator doors framework body comprises up and down end cap and left and right side frame, and conventional way is with up and down end cap and the independent extrusion molding of left and right side frame, and then end cap and left and right side frame assembly unit become refrigerator doorframe frame body up and down.The preparation method of refrigerator doors framework body has following defective: 1, need doping in the raw material of extrusion molding, yet it is aging easily to have added the raw material behind the additive, outward appearance is of low grade; 2, because up and down end cap and the independent extrusion molding of left and right side frame, so that the colour consistency of end cap and left and right side frame is relatively poor up and down, affect attractive in appearance; 3, the raw material alternative costs of extrusion molding are higher; 4, the product accuracy of extrusion molding is relatively poor, size occurring easily when end cap and left and right side frame assembly unit up and down misfits, not only so that the assembly unit Efficiency Decreasing, and in foaming process, in case occur up and down the slit when end cap and left and right side frame assembly unit, foamed material can overflow refrigerator doors framework body, affects quality.
The preparation method of existing glass refrigerator doors has following defective: face glass is to be embedded in the glass caulking groove of refrigerator doors framework body, so in the refrigerator doors preparation process, must face glass be embedded in the glass caulking groove first, then add expanded material, be loaded on backboard and carry out foaming.In the foaming process of expanded material, because the quality problems of glass itself or technological temperature do not control well, and some other reasonses cause face glass cracked, find just that after foaming is finished late, refrigerator doors becomes waste product.
Therefore be eager to seek a kind of novel refrigerator doors, not only have good performance attractive in appearance, also want long service life to enhance productivity the rate of reducing the number of rejects and seconds so that reduce in process of production cost.
Summary of the invention
The purpose of this utility model is to overcome above-mentioned deficiency, and a kind of front Rimless glass refrigerator doors is provided, and it not only has good performance attractive in appearance, and can also so that reduce in process of production cost, enhance productivity the rate of reducing the number of rejects and seconds long service life.
The purpose of this utility model is achieved in that
A kind of front Rimless glass refrigerator doors, it comprises refrigerator doors framework body, the front of described refrigerator doors framework body and the back side are respectively equipped with face glass and door body backboard, be filled with foaming layer between described refrigerator doors framework body, face glass and the door body backboard, described face glass is laminated with in the front of refrigerator doors framework body.
As a kind of preferred, described refrigerator doors framework body is injection mo(u)lding.
As a kind of preferred, described refrigerator doors framework body comprises up and down end cap and left and right side frame, and described up and down end cap and left and right side frame are injection mo(u)lding.
As a kind of preferred, be provided with laterally in the described refrigerator doors framework body or reinforcement longitudinally.
As a kind of preferred, be provided with computer control panel in the described refrigerator doors framework body.
Compared with prior art, the beneficial effects of the utility model are:
1, because refrigerator doors framework body is injection mo(u)lding, and raw material does not need doping, and color can be chosen wantonly, product is difficult for aging, and the outward appearance class is high;
2, because refrigerator doors framework body is injection mo(u)lding, so that the colour consistency of the up and down end cap of refrigerator doors framework body and left and right side frame is better, guarantee performance attractive in appearance;
3, the raw material of injection mo(u)lding can be feed back, and is low by 30% ~ 40% than the cost of material of extrusion molding, can also carry out surface spraying after the injection mo(u)lding, increases aesthetic feeling;
4, the refrigerator doors framework body accuracy of injection mo(u)lding is higher, size is coincide easily when end cap and left and right side frame assembly unit up and down, not only so that the raising of assembly unit efficient, and the slit can not appear when end cap and left and right side frame assembly unit up and down, in foaming process, foamed material can not overflow refrigerator doors framework body, affects quality;
5, in the refrigerator doors preparation process, foaming first is laminated with face glass afterwards, badly also can not waste face glass if foam, if face glass is bad, also can not affect miscellaneous part, and percent defective is lower.
More than comprehensive, this utility model has good performance attractive in appearance, can also so that reduce in process of production cost, enhance productivity the rate of reducing the number of rejects and seconds long service life.
